What Migrate Mate does

Migrate Mate is a job search platform for international professionals looking for U.S. jobs with visa sponsorship. We aggregate job listings where employers have a track record of sponsoring work visas, and we give you tools to search, filter, and connect with those employers directly.

The platform covers:

  • E-3 visas for Australian professionals
  • H-1B visas for specialty occupation workers
  • F-1 OPT/CPT for international students
  • TN visas for Canadian and Mexican professionals
  • H-1B1 visas for professionals from Chile and Singapore
  • J-1 visas for exchange visitors
  • EB-2/EB-3 green cards for employment-based permanent residence

Salary transparency

Job opening on Migrate Mate showcasing the salary range

Most listings include salary ranges. For H-1B candidates, this is strategically important: under the wage-weighted lottery system, higher salaries mean more lottery entries. Knowing the salary upfront helps you target roles at wage levels that improve your selection odds.
